Horticulture hort 497b was the first green roof technologies class in the nation created at penn state in 2005 and is taught every spring semester with students from many disciplines participating.
On an annual basis a 3 5 4 deep sedum green roof in central pennsylvania can retain approximately 50 60 of the annual rainfall.

In the cool season months less water is retained 20 30 on average figure 1.
Green roofs are unique in that they have the ability to capture and retain a volume depth of rain from each rainstorm.

The hub s green roof a gift from the class of 2014 and constructed as part of the hub robeson center addition and renovation project the hub green roof opened in summer 2016 as a space for penn staters to relax and enjoy nature from the center of campus.
